BGC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

266 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BGC Group (BGC)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$1.84B — up 18% from $1.55B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 55 funds opened new BGC positions and 30 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 93 added to existing stakes and 77 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Principal Financial Group, adding an estimated $19.7M. The largest seller was Schroder Investment Management Group, cutting an estimated $30.8M.
